PPCRV now process poll-related data from Comelec
MANILA, Philippines — The Parish Pastoral Council for Responsible Voting (PPCRV) is already processing the poll-related data it received from the Commission on Elections (Comelec), according to spokesperson Ana Singson.
“We received the file. We are currently processing that file. So we hope to be able to show you data very soon,” Singson updated reporters on Monday night.
“We can’t give you more information than that because we are processing the file right now. However, we did receive a file with content because the previous file only had headers. So we are processing the file now and we hope to be able to show you data very soon,” she added.

Earlier, Singson revealed that 34.38 percent of votes have already been transmitted to transparency servers, but the PPCRV has zero access to this data.
Singson described the occurrence as “unusual,” which had not happened since 2010.
“This has not happened since 2010, when we have not received even a first dump when over one-third of the data has already been transmitted. We understand that Comelec is meeting right now,” she added. /cb
